Description

Our client, a Business Solutions company, is looking for a Claims Examiner – Auto for their Irving, TX location.
 
Responsibilities:
  • To analyze and process complex auto and commercial transportation claims by reviewing coverage, completing investigations, determining liability and evaluating the scope of damages.
  • Processes complex auto commercial and personal line claims, including bodily injury and ensures claim files are properly documented and coded correctly.
  • Responsible for litigation process on litigated claims.
  • Coordinates vendor management, including the use of independent adjusters to assist the investigation of claims.
  • Reports large claims to excess carrier(s).
  • Develops and maintains action plans to ensure state required contact deadlines are met and to move the file towards prompt and appropriate resolution.
  • Identifies and pursues subrogation and risk transfer opportunities; secures and disposes of salvage.
  • Communicates claim action/processing with insured, client, and agent or broker when appropriate.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Supports the organization's quality program(s).
  • Travels as required.
 
Requirements:
  • Experienced in complex liability and coverage.
  • TPA experience a plus.
  • Bodily injury/uninsured/underinsured motorist handling experience to include demonstrable (fatality, fractures, traumatic brain injury) handling.
  • (USD) threshold handling up to 1 million.
  • No fault (Personal Injury Protection) experience.
  • Litigation handling experience pertaining to BI/UM/UIM** Not all candidates will need this but a minimum of 3 will need litigation handling experience.
  • Auto Physical Damage handling experience preferred.
  • Experience working in a fast-paced environment, participating in and presenting cases to both internal and external stakeholders.
  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university preferred. Professional certification as applicable to line of business preferred.
  • Secure and maintain the State adjusting licenses as required for the position.
  • Experience Five (5) years of claims management experience or equivalent combination of education and experience required to include in-depth knowledge of personal and commercial line auto policies, coverage’s, principles, and laws.
